Passos seguintes recomendados

Esta página aplica-se ao Apigee e ao Apigee Hybrid.

Veja a documentação do Apigee Edge.

O que está a fazer neste passo

Siga os passos abaixo para criar e implementar um proxy de API de teste. Por último, teste o proxy de API enviando-lhe um pedido HTTP.

Crie e implemente um proxy de API

O processo de aprovisionamento do Apigee não cria nem implementa automaticamente um proxy de API para si. Tem de criar e implementar um proxy manualmente.

IU do Apigee na Cloud Console

Para criar e implementar o seu primeiro proxy:

  1. Na Google Cloud consola, aceda à página Desenvolvimento de proxy > Proxies de API.

    Aceda aos proxies de API

  2. Certifique-se de que o nome da sua organização está selecionado no seletor de projetos no painel do Google Cloud. O nome da organização é igual ao nome do projeto. Google Cloud
  3. Clique em + Criar.

    É apresentada a página Criar um proxy.

  4. Na caixa Modelo de proxy, selecione Proxy inverso (mais comum).
  5. No Passo 1: detalhes do proxy, configure o proxy com os seguintes valores:
    Nome do parâmetro Valor
    Nome do proxy hello-world
    Caminho base /hello-world
    Destino (API existente) mocktarget.apigee.net
  6. Clicar em Seguinte.
  7. No Passo 2: implemente (opcional):
    • Ambientes de implementação: opcional. Use as caixas de verificação para selecionar um ou mais ambientes nos quais implementar o proxy. Se preferir não implementar o proxy neste momento, deixe o campo Ambientes de implementação vazio. Pode sempre implementar o proxy mais tarde.
    • Conta de serviço: opcional. Anexe uma conta de serviço à sua implementação para permitir que o proxy aceda aos serviços, conforme especificado na função e nas autorizações da conta de serviço. Google Cloud
  8. Clique em Criar.

    O novo proxy de API é criado e implementado no ambiente selecionado.

  9. É apresentada a página Resumo do proxy do proxy recém-criado. Uma marca de verificação verde em Estado indica que o proxy foi implementado com êxito. Se o proxy não estiver implementado, consulte o artigo Implementar um proxy de API e siga os passos para o implementar manualmente.
  10. No painel de navegação do lado esquerdo, selecione Gestão > Ambientes > Grupos de ambientes.
  11. Copie o nome do anfitrião do grupo de ambientes. Vai usar este nome de anfitrião para chamar o proxy da API nos passos seguintes.

Apigee clássico

Para criar e implementar o seu primeiro proxy:

  1. Inicie sessão na IU do Apigee.
  2. Certifique-se de que o nome da sua organização está selecionado no menu pendente no canto superior esquerdo da IU. O nome da organização é igual ao nome do seu projeto do Google Cloud.
  3. Clique em Proxies de API na vista principal.
  4. Na lista pendente Selecionar ambiente, selecione um ambiente.
  5. Clique em Criar novo.
  6. Clique em Proxy inverso (mais comum).
  7. Na página Detalhes do proxy, configure o proxy com os seguintes valores:
    Nome do parâmetro Valor
    Nome hello-world
    Caminho base /hello-world
    Destino (API existente) https://mocktarget.apigee.net
  8. Clicar em Seguinte.
  9. Na página Políticas comuns, em Segurança: Autorização, selecione Passar (sem autorização).
  10. Clicar em Seguinte.
  11. Na página Resumo, em Implementação opcional, selecione o ambiente no qual implementar o proxy.
  12. Clique em Criar e implementar.

    O novo proxy de API é criado e implementado no ambiente selecionado.

  13. Clique em Aceder à lista de proxies. Uma marca de verificação verde em Estado indica que o proxy foi implementado com êxito. Se o proxy não estiver implementado, consulte Implementar um proxy de API e siga os passos para o implementar manualmente.
  14. No painel de navegação do lado esquerdo, selecione Administração > Ambientes > Grupos.
  15. Clique em Ver na Google Cloud consola.
  16. Copie o nome do anfitrião do grupo de ambientes. Vai usar este nome de anfitrião para chamar o proxy da API nos passos seguintes.
  17. Feche a Google Cloud consola.

Ligue para o proxy com acesso interno

Se permitiu o acesso interno no Passo 4: Personalize o encaminhamento de acesso, siga as instruções em: Chamar um proxy de API com acesso apenas interno.

Chame o proxy com acesso externo

Se permitiu o acesso externo no Passo 4: Personalize o encaminhamento de acesso, siga estes passos:

  1. Configure uma entrada DNS para o seu anfitrião. Seguem-se duas formas de realizar esta tarefa:
    • Na entidade de registo, crie um registo A que direcione o nome de anfitrião do grupo de ambientes para o IP apresentado na página do assistente em Configurar DNS. Por exemplo, se o nome do anfitrião for sales.example.com e o IP for 10.23.0.2, direcione o registo de sales.example.com para o endereço 10.23.0.2.
    • Use o Cloud DNS da Google para mapear um URL para um endereço IP.
  2. Teste o proxy da API enviando o seguinte pedido numa janela de terminal:
    curl -v -H "Host:YOUR_ENV_GROUP_HOSTNAME" \
      https://YOUR_INSTANCE_IP_OR_DNS/hello-world

    Onde:

    • O valor do cabeçalho Host (YOUR_ENV_GROUP_HOSTNAME) é o nome do anfitrião da página Ambientes > Grupos de ambientes.

    Um pedido bem-sucedido devolve a string: Hello, Guest!. Se o seu pedido não for bem-sucedido, consulte a secção Resolução de problemas.

Passos seguintes